Verifique un ID de proveedor

Para verificar tu ID del proveedor (VID) emitido por Connectivity Standards Alliance (Alliance), deberás generar un archivo JSON de transacción y ejecutar el comando en Google Home Developer Console.

Asegúrate de realizar este proceso en una máquina con acceso a la herramienta de línea de comandos dcld y a la cuenta de DCL adecuada para tu VID.

Claves de la IU web de DCL

Si creaste tu cuenta de DCL y las claves asociadas con la IU web de DCL, debes importarlas a dcld antes de poder verificar tu VID.

Frase mnemónica

  1. Ubica tu frase mnemónica de recuperación. Deberías haber guardado la frase mnemónica cuando creaste la clave en la IU web. La frase mnemónica consta de 24 palabras.
  2. Si no tienes dcld, asegúrate de tener instalado goLang 1.3.

    También hay una versión precompilada de DCL para Ubuntu. Consulta el libro mayor de cumplimiento distribuido (DCL) en GitHub para obtener más información.

  3. Importa tu clave con la frase mnemónica BIP39. Ingresa el siguiente comando en dcld.

    dcld keys add mykey --recover
    Enter your bip39 mnemonic
    found obscure learn obtain suffer dish crazy clinic layer expose negative
    siege alley drop issue expect horror strike hold catalog simple tongue
    draw filter
    {"name":"jack","type":"local","address":"cosmos1n78djl9spdwcwrmq2z8skxeqqcz7q3n9rhu9ml","pubkey":
    "{\"@type\":\"/cosmos.crypto.secp256k1.PubKey\",\"key\":\"AghA9HLRUhOAQzC0ZWzZGcPEPtKrGSIpQ4uhjXH9ZNcr\"}"}
    

Tu clave ya debería estar importada y deberías poder ejecutar los comandos de firma según lo solicitado por nuestra Developer Console.

Frase mnemónica

Tu frase mnemónica BIP39 se puede usar para recuperar o reconstruir tus claves secretas. No compartas tu frase mnemónica. Debe mantenerse privada y segura como si fuera tu clave privada de DCL.

Si no creaste una copia de seguridad de tu frase mnemónica de recuperación, no hay una forma directa de recuperar o importar tus claves de DCL para usarlas con dcld.

Titular de la cuenta

La verificación de VID requiere una cuenta de mainnet del libro mayor de cumplimiento distribuido (DCL); no se admite testnet. Si eres titular de una cuenta de tu empresa, para verificar tu VID, haz lo siguiente:

Ir a Developer Console

  1. En la lista de proyectos, haz clic en Abrir junto al proyecto con el que deseas trabajar.

  2. Haz clic en Develop.

  3. En ID del proveedor (VID), selecciona Alliance-issued vendor ID (para certificar) y, luego, ingresa tu ID del proveedor emitido por Alliance.

  4. Haz clic en Verificar VID para continuar.

    Verifica el VID

  5. Se genera una transacción de DCL.

    Primer comando de VID

  6. Abre una ventana de terminal.

    1. Si nunca usaste dcld, importa la clave ejecutando el siguiente comando:

      dcld keys import key-name key-file

      Se te pedirá que ingreses la frase de contraseña de desencriptación para la clave exportada que se usó durante el proceso de exportación.

  7. Copia y ejecuta el primer comando como se muestra.

  8. Ahora ejecuta el segundo comando en tu terminal.

    Segundo comando de VID

  9. Pega el resultado del segundo comando y haz clic en Enviar. Pega el comando de resultado

  10. Se verificará la propiedad de tu VID.

    • Si se verifica tu VID de producción, recibirás una marca de verificación verde. Haz clic en Guardar y continuar para finalizar. Se verificó el VID
    • Si se rechaza tu VID de producción, recibirás un signo de exclamación rojo con los problemas que debes corregir.

Titular de clave que no es titular de la cuenta

Si no eres titular de una cuenta de DCL, debes trabajar con un titular de la cuenta para verificar el VID.

Si el titular de la cuenta tiene acceso a Developer Console, pídele que verifique el VID siguiendo las instrucciones que se indican en Titular de la cuenta.

Si el titular de la cuenta no tiene acceso a Developer Console, haz lo siguiente:

  1. Obtén los comandos generados y envíalos al titular de la cuenta.
  2. Ingresa el resultado del segundo comando y haz clic en Enviar.
  3. Se verificará la propiedad de tu VID.
    • Si se verifica tu VID de producción, recibirás una marca de verificación verde. Haz clic en Guardar y continuar para finalizar. Se verificó el VID
    • Si se rechaza tu VID de producción, recibirás un signo de exclamación rojo con los problemas que debes corregir.